Early documented proposal linking identity verification to infrastructure access
Alliance KYBC proposal — internal August2020
This is the Alliance for Intellectual Property's business-verification proposal in its response to the CMA Digital Markets Taskforce, internally dated August 2020. It advocates stronger identity checks by critical online services and consequences for businesses withholding identifying information.
Document and policy status
The CMA published the response on 8 December 2020; that date is not its receipt date or a decision adopting it. The proposal predates RUSI's March 2021 report. The Alliance's separately captured Online Accountability page advocates verification across hosts, advertising, proxies, payment services and marketplaces. The records establish a continuing advocacy theme, without proving identical wording over time or an enacted general duty.
